Unbeaten Warriors Clash: Benavidez vs. Morrell – Fight Night Expectations

On February 2nd, a highly anticipated showdown between unbeaten light-heavyweight contenders David Benavidez and David Morrell is set to take center stage. Available on PBC Pay-Per-View via Prime Video across various countries, the bout promises a thrilling encounter not to be missed. Viewers in the UK can join the action at 1:00 AM GMT, while fans in the USA can experience the excitement at 8:00 PM ET or 5:00 PM PT, perfectly scheduled to coincide with the local Las Vegas time. The atmosphere is electric as fight fans eagerly await the main event ringwalks, anticipated around 4:00 AM GMT for UK viewers, and 11:00 PM ET/8:00 PM PT for USA audiences.

This clash is not merely a contest of athletic prowess; it’s an intense rivalry with genuine animosity simmering beneath the surface. The intensity has been palpable in the lead-up to the fight, characterized by heated exchanges, physical confrontations, and personal insults. Both fighters have spoken openly about their desire to not only win but to dominate, raising the stakes significantly. As both men enter the ring unbeaten—Benavidez at 29-0 with 24 knockouts and Morrell at 11-0 with 9 knockouts—the question of who will emerge victorious looms large, a narrative of resilience, skill, and ferocity.

Competing for the WBC interim title, the winner of this bout is poised for a significant opportunity—a likely chance to face the victor of the impending rematch between Artur Beterbiev and Dmitry Bivol, further intensifying the competition. David Benavidez, often dubbed “The Mexican Monster,” embodies the archetype of an aggressive puncher. Critics argue that his defensive skills may leave room for improvement; however, his ferocity and power make him a riveting spectacle to watch. The question remains—can Morrell, a Cuban southpaw known for his technical skills, find a way to penetrate Benavidez’s defenses? While Benavidez relies on his chin and explosive punching, Morrell’s strategy will be crucial: he claims to possess a more refined skill set. As they step into the ring, the strategies each fighter employs will be put to the ultimate test.
